How Do Game Developers Use AI to Improve Player Experience?

How Do Game Developers Use AI to Improve Player Experience?


In the rapidly evolving world of video games, one might wonder how the industry continues to push the boundaries of what’s possible. The answer lies in the innovative use of AI for gamers. As someone deeply passionate about gaming, I’ve noticed how Game Developers have increasingly harnessed the power of artificial intelligence to create experiences that are not only more immersive but also more tailored to the individual player. This shift has transformed gaming, taking it from a simple pastime to a deeply personal and engaging activity. Let’s explore how AI is shaping the future of gaming and making it more enjoyable for everyone.



A Brief History of AI in Gaming

To truly appreciate the current advancements, it’s important to understand how AI for gamers has evolved over time. In the early days of gaming, AI was relatively simple. Early Game Developers used basic algorithms to control enemy behavior, which often led to predictable and repetitive gameplay. However, as technology advanced, so did the complexity of AI.

The Evolution from Pong to Pac-Man

The journey began with games like Pong in 1972, where the AI’s only job was to mimic a human opponent’s paddle movements. Then came Pac-Man in 1980, where the ghosts were programmed with distinct behaviors, making the game more challenging and engaging. Game Developers quickly realized the potential of AI to create more complex and enjoyable experiences for players.

The Rise of AI in the 1990s

The 1990s saw significant advancements in AI for gamers. Game Developers began experimenting with more sophisticated AI, such as the pathfinding algorithms used in Command & Conquer and the strategic thinking required in Chessmaster. These innovations paved the way for the AI-driven games we see today.

The Modern Era of AI in Gaming

Today, AI is integral to game development. From the way enemies react in real-time to the procedural generation of vast worlds, AI for gamers has transformed how games are made and played. Modern Game Developers have access to a wealth of tools and technologies that allow them to create experiences that are not only visually stunning but also deeply engaging and personalized.


AI-Driven Storytelling in Games

One of the most intriguing applications of AI for gamers is in storytelling. Traditional game narratives are often linear, with predefined paths and outcomes. However, Game Developers are now using AI to create dynamic stories that evolve based on player choices, creating a more personalized and immersive experience.

Example: Detroit: Become Human

Take Detroit: Become Human as an example. This game uses AI for gamers to track every decision a player makes, altering the narrative accordingly. The result is a story that feels personal and unique, with multiple endings based on the choices you make. Game Developers have praised this approach for its ability to create a more emotionally engaging experience.

Embed YouTube Video: Detroit: Become Human – How Your Choices Matter

AI in Open-World Games

In open-world games, AI for gamers plays a crucial role in creating a living, breathing world. Game Developers use AI to populate these worlds with NPCs that have their own routines, behaviors, and interactions. This adds depth and realism, making the world feel alive and reactive to the player’s actions.

Example: Red Dead Redemption 2

Red Dead Redemption 2 is a prime example of this. The game’s AI controls not just the NPCs, but the wildlife, weather, and even the economy within the game. Game Developers have created a world where every action has a consequence, making the experience deeply immersive and personal.

Embed YouTube Video: Red Dead Redemption 2 – The World’s AI Explained


AI in Game Design: Creating Smarter Challenges

One of the most significant ways AI for gamers is used in game development is in creating smarter, more adaptive challenges. Game Developers use AI to design enemies and obstacles that can learn and adapt to the player’s strategies, ensuring that the game remains challenging and engaging throughout.

Dynamic AI Opponents

Gone are the days when enemies followed simple patterns that players could easily exploit. Modern AI for gamers allows NPCs to analyze player behavior, adapt their tactics, and even predict future actions. This creates a more dynamic and unpredictable gameplay experience.

Example: Halo’s Enemy AI

In the Halo series, Game Developers have implemented AI that adapts to the player’s tactics. If you rely too much on one weapon or strategy, the enemies will change their behavior to counter it. This keeps the game challenging and forces players to continually adapt their approach.

Embed YouTube Video: Halo’s AI – How Enemies Learn

AI-Generated Quests and Missions

Another innovative use of AI for gamers is in the generation of quests and missions. Game Developers can use AI to create endless variations of quests, ensuring that players always have something new and exciting to do. This not only extends the game’s lifespan but also keeps players engaged for longer.

Example: The Radiant AI System in Skyrim

The Elder Scrolls V: Skyrim uses a system known as Radiant AI to generate quests based on the player’s actions. This system ensures that even after completing the main storyline, players can continue to find new and unique quests tailored to their playstyle.

Embed YouTube Video: Skyrim’s Radiant AI Explained


AI in Game Development Tools

AI for gamers isn’t just used in the games themselves; it’s also a powerful tool for Game Developers during the development process. AI can assist in everything from level design to bug testing, making the development process more efficient and allowing developers to focus on creativity.

AI in Level Design

Level design is a complex and time-consuming task. However, AI for gamers can automate much of this process. By using procedural generation and machine learning, Game Developers can create levels that are not only expansive but also intricately detailed.

Example: AI-Driven Level Design in Dead Cells

Dead Cells uses AI to generate its levels, ensuring that no two playthroughs are the same. The AI considers the player’s skill level, playstyle, and past performance to create levels that are both challenging and rewarding.

Embed YouTube Video: How Dead Cells Uses AI for Level Design

AI in Bug Detection and Quality Assurance

Another area where AI for gamers is making a significant impact is in quality assurance. Game Developers can use AI to detect bugs and issues more efficiently than traditional testing methods. AI-driven testing tools can simulate thousands of scenarios in a fraction of the time, identifying problems that might be missed by human testers.

Example: AI in Ubisoft’s Bug Testing

Ubisoft has implemented AI-driven testing tools that can automatically play through games, identifying bugs and glitches that need to be addressed. This allows Game Developers to focus on refining the gameplay experience, knowing that the AI is handling much of the tedious bug detection process.

Embed YouTube Video: Ubisoft’s AI Testing Tools


AI and Player Behavior Analysis

Understanding player behavior is crucial for Game Developers who want to create engaging and satisfying experiences. AI for gamers is now being used to analyze player behavior in real-time, providing valuable insights that can be used to refine and improve the game.

Real-Time Data Collection

Modern games collect vast amounts of data on how players interact with the game. Game Developers use AI for gamers to analyze this data, identifying patterns and trends that can inform future updates and expansions. This allows developers to create content that resonates with players and keeps them coming back for more.

Example: Player Behavior Analysis in Fortnite

Fortnite uses AI to analyze player behavior and preferences. This data is then used to inform everything from game balance to new content releases. Game Developers can see which weapons, strategies, and playstyles are most popular, allowing them to tailor the game to meet player expectations.

Embed YouTube Video: How Fortnite Uses AI to Analyze Player Behavior

Predictive Analytics

AI for gamers also enables predictive analytics, where Game Developers can anticipate how players might react to new content or changes. This allows them to make more informed decisions, reducing the risk of negative player feedback.

Example: Predictive Analytics in Mobile Games

Many mobile games use AI for gamers to predict player churn (when players stop playing a game). By analyzing in-game behavior, Game Developers can identify players at risk of leaving and offer them incentives to stay, such as personalized offers or new content.

Embed YouTube Video: Predictive Analytics in Mobile Games


AI and Virtual Reality (VR)

The integration of AI for gamers with virtual reality (VR) is opening up new possibilities for immersive gaming experiences. Game Developers are using AI to create more interactive and responsive VR environments, making the virtual worlds feel more real and engaging.

AI-Driven VR Worlds

In VR games, AI is used to create environments that react to the player’s actions in real-time. Whether it’s NPCs that respond to your movements or dynamic environments that change based on your interactions, AI for gamers is making VR experiences more immersive than ever.

Example: AI in Half-Life: Alyx

Half-Life: Alyx is a standout example of how Game Developers are using AI to enhance VR experiences. The game’s AI controls everything from enemy behavior to environmental interactions, creating a world that feels alive and responsive to the player’s actions.

Embed YouTube Video: Half-Life: Alyx – AI in VR Explained

Personalized VR Experiences

AI for gamers also allows for personalized VR experiences. By analyzing player preferences and behavior, Game Developers can tailor the VR environment to suit individual playstyles, making the experience more personal and engaging.

Example: Personalized VR in The Walking Dead: Saints & Sinners

In The Walking Dead: Saints & Sinners, the AI adapts the game’s difficulty and content based on the player’s actions and decisions. This ensures that each playthrough feels unique and tailored to the player’s preferences.

Embed YouTube Video: The Walking Dead: Saints & Sinners – Personalized VR


Ethical Considerations in AI-Driven Games

While the advancements in AI for gamers are exciting, they also raise important ethical questions. Game Developers must consider the potential impact of AI on players, including issues related to privacy, fairness, and the potential for AI to manipulate player behavior.

Privacy Concerns

The use of AI for gamers often involves the collection and analysis of large amounts of player data. Game Developers must ensure that this data is handled responsibly and that players’ privacy is protected. This includes being transparent about what data is collected and how it is used.

Example: Data Privacy in Gaming

Some games have faced criticism for not being transparent about their data collection practices. Game Developers must navigate these challenges carefully to maintain player trust and avoid potential backlash.

Embed YouTube Video: Data Privacy in Gaming

Fairness in AI-Driven Games

Another ethical concern is fairness. AI for gamers must be designed in a way that ensures all players have a fair and enjoyable experience. Game Developers need to be mindful of how AI might create imbalances or unfair advantages, particularly in competitive games.

Example: AI Fairness in Competitive Games

In competitive games like League of Legends, Game Developers must ensure that AI-driven matchmaking is fair and that no player is given an unfair advantage. This requires constant monitoring and adjustment to keep the playing field level.

Embed YouTube Video: AI Fairness in Competitive Gaming

The Manipulative Potential of AI

Finally, there is the concern that AI for gamers could be used to manipulate player behavior, encouraging spending or addictive play patterns. Game Developers must strike a balance between creating engaging experiences and avoiding practices that could be harmful to players.

Example: Ethical AI Use in Free-to-Play Games

In free-to-play games, Game Developers often use AI for gamers to encourage in-game purchases. While this can be a valid business strategy, it’s important that these practices don’t become predatory or exploitative.

Embed YouTube Video: Ethical AI Use in Free-to-Play Games


AI and the Future of Game Development

As we look to the future, the role of AI for gamers in game development is only expected to grow. Game Developers are continually finding new and innovative ways to use AI to create more immersive, personalized, and engaging experiences. However, this also brings new challenges and responsibilities.

The Potential of AI in Creating Entirely New Genres

One exciting possibility is the creation of entirely new game genres that are driven by AI for gamers. Game Developers could use AI to create games that learn and evolve over time, offering experiences that are truly unique to each player.

Example: AI-Driven Evolutionary Games

Imagine a game that adapts and evolves based on the collective actions of its player base. Such a game could offer endless possibilities and replayability, as the AI constantly generates new content and challenges.

Embed YouTube Video: The Future of AI in Gaming

AI as a Creative Partner

As AI technology continues to advance, there is potential for AI to become a creative partner for Game Developers. AI could assist in generating ideas, designing levels, and even writing storylines, allowing for even more innovative and diverse games.

Example: AI-Generated Art and Music in Games

We’re already seeing the beginnings of this with AI-generated art and music in games. Game Developers can use AI tools to create assets that are unique and tailored to the game’s aesthetic, enhancing the overall experience.

Embed YouTube Video: AI in Game Art and Music

The Responsibility of Game Developers

With great power comes great responsibility. As Game Developers continue to explore the potential of AI for gamers, they must also be mindful of the ethical and social implications of their work. This includes ensuring that AI is used to create positive and enriching experiences for players, rather than exploitative or harmful ones.


Conclusion: Embracing the Future of AI in Gaming

As someone who loves gaming, it’s incredible to see how far the industry has come with the help of AI for gamers. Game Developers are using AI to push the boundaries of what’s possible, creating games that are more immersive, personalized, and engaging than ever before. But while AI offers tremendous potential, it’s important to remember that it’s just one tool in the developer’s toolbox. The true magic of gaming comes from the creativity, passion, and vision of the people behind the games.

As we move forward, I’m excited to see how Game Developers will continue to innovate with AI for gamers. Whether it’s through creating smarter enemies, more dynamic worlds, or entirely new genres, the future of gaming looks brighter than ever. And as a player, I can’t wait to be part of this exciting journey.


For More Information


References

  1. “The Role of AI in Gaming” – TechRadar. Link
  2. “How AI is Changing Game Development” – GameSpot. Link
  3. “AI and Ethics in Gaming” – Gamasutra. Link
  4. “The Future of AI in Games” – IGN. Link
  5. “AI in Game Development: Challenges and Opportunities” – Polygon. Link

Leave a Comment